树莓派与 Python —— GPIO

首先来直观地认识树莓派提供的 40 个引脚(GPIO,general purpose i/o,接收外界输入,并向外界提供运算处理后的输出):



1. 安装

  • 从远程库(repositories)中下载安装

    $ sudo apt-get update
    $ sudo apt-get dist-update
    $ sudo apt-get install python-rpi.gpio
        # python 3:sudo apt-get install python3-rpi.gpio
  • 从源程序中安装:

    源文件的下载地址为:RPi.GPIO 0.6.3(或 raspberry-gpio-python

    $ sudo tar -zxvf RPi.GPIO-0.6.3.tar.gz
    $ cd RPi.GPIO-0.6.3
    $ python setup.py install

2. 基本api

import RPi.GPIO as GPIO
import time

pin = 7                         ## 使用7号引脚
GPIO.setmode(GPIO.BOARD)        ## 使用BOARD引脚编号,此外还有 GPIO.BCM
GPIO.setup(pin, GPIO.OUT)       ## 设置7号引脚输出

while:                  ## 重复
    GPIO.output(pin, GPIO.HIGH) ## 打开 GPIO 引脚(HIGH)
    time.sleep(1)               ## 等1秒
    GPIO.output(pin, GPIO.LOW)  ## 关闭 GPIO 引脚(LOW)
    time.sleep(1)               ## 等1秒

PIO.cleanup()                   ## 清除
  • 2
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

五道口纳什

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值